Most shocks or struts last anywhere from 50,000 to 100,000 miles. Replacing shocks is a little less expensive, and you will. An individual strut assembly will cost roughly $150 to $350, excluding labor. Replacing shocks and struts is not cheap, and you can expect to pay anywhere from $500 to $1,200 to replace a pair of struts. How much should it cost to replace your suspension? Shocks can be replaced relatively affordably on reasonably priced mainstream cars as long as the mounting points are not damaged or corroded. You can expect a total replacement cost of between $200 and $750 for a pair of shocks, with the front shocks a bit more expensive than the rear. With no assembly, the strut on its own can save you around $40 to $80. Shocks should be replaced in pairs, either in the front or rear. $500 to $1,000 is a budget for such a job. Parts alone could cost $100 to $350, while the rest of the money will be spent on labor.
